Why Local Co-op Indie Games Are So Popular
Local co-op indie games have gained popularity for several reasons. Here are some of the key factors that contribute to their appeal:
-
Unique Gameplay: Indie developers often push the boundaries of traditional gaming, creating unique and innovative gameplay experiences that are not available in mainstream titles.
-
Strong Community: The local co-op genre has fostered a strong sense of community among players, with many forming lasting friendships through shared gaming experiences.
-
Accessibility: Local co-op indie games are typically more accessible than online multiplayer titles, as they don’t require an internet connection or a dedicated server.
-
Value for Money: Many local co-op indie games offer a high-quality experience at a fraction of the cost of mainstream titles.
